A Welfare Assessment Method is an evaluation systematic assessment method that can determine welfare condition levels through welfare indicator measurement.
- AKA: Well-being Evaluation Method, Welfare Measurement Approach, Welfare Assessment Protocol.

- It can range from being a Qualitative Welfare Assessment Method to being a Quantitative Welfare Assessment Method, depending on its welfare assessment data type.
- It can range from being a Single-Domain Welfare Assessment Method to being a Multi-Domain Welfare Assessment Method, depending on its welfare assessment scope breadth.
- It can range from being a Resource-Based Welfare Assessment Method to being an Outcome-Based Welfare Assessment Method, depending on its welfare assessment focus point.
- It can range from being a Snapshot Welfare Assessment Method to being a Longitudinal Welfare Assessment Method, depending on its welfare assessment temporal span.
- It can range from being a Universal Welfare Assessment Method to being a Context-Specific Welfare Assessment Method, depending on its welfare assessment applicability range.

- Counter-Example(s):
- Performance Measurement Methods, which assess productivity metrics rather than welfare states.
- Financial Audit Methods, which evaluate monetary compliance rather than well-being conditions.
- Quality Control Methods, which test product standards rather than welfare outcomes.
- Risk Assessment Methods, which identify potential hazards rather than current welfare.
- Diagnostic Test Methods, which detect specific conditions rather than overall welfare.
